Who: Tonks and [OPEN]
What: Exploration and dragons?
When: Saturday afternoon, April 2nd



Tonks had been in Cardiff, in the year 1999, no more than a few hours when two things happened. One, she was tired of hanging out in the new digs which, while very nice, was rather different than her small flat in Chiswick. She had actually demurred on the given quarters, but was kindly reminded that her flat may no longer be her own. Four years had past, after all, and a lot could change in four years. After pointed questions, she also found out that they were attempting to keep everyone who came in through the Rift in a central location as to keep them close while figuring things out.

The pink-haired woman attempted to grill them on a few other things and, while they weren't exactly forthright with their information, their demeanor made Tonks believe a few things about her future.

So it was with those thoughts in mind that she decided to go for a walk and check the area out. She had never been to Cardiff before at any rate, so the exploration would probably do her some good. Tonks stepped out then, rolling the shoulder that had been banged up during the battle and that the Ministry was good enough to patch up while orientating her, and looked around. It was then that she saw something that perhaps was strange for Cardiff. There was a dragon, a Common Welsh if memory and hours of listening to Charlie Weasley back in school served correctly, perched atop of a building. Just like a very large gargoyle.

The pink-haired woman looked around, watching as others looked upon the creature warily but attempting to mind their own business as not to catch its attention, and then made her way closer. Just to make sure everything was okay.
